Serratiopeptidase is a proteolytic enzyme isolated from the non-pathogenic intestinal bacterium Serratia E15. It is characterized by fibrinolytic, anti-inflammatory and anti-edematous activity. Serratiopeptidase relieves pain by blocking the release of painful amines from inflamed tissues. It has the ability to break down protein compounds in the body. The main action of serratiopeptidase is to reduce inflammation and provide pain relief. It penetrates the affected tissue, where it breaks down protein components that cause inflammation, thereby reducing the intensity of the inflammatory process. In addition, serratiopeptidase can help reduce swelling by reducing the amount of substances that attract fluid to the site of inflammation. This effect helps to facilitate tissue movement and accelerates their healing. The drug penetrates well into inflammation sites, lyses necrotic tissues and their decay products, reduces hyperemia and accelerates the penetration and activity of antibiotics. The medicine reduces the viscosity of saliva and nasal discharge, thereby facilitating their removal.
